Medical supply chain logistics services have become increasingly critical for healthcare systems, hospitals, clinics, pharmaceutical providers, and medical manufacturers managing complex healthcare distribution networks. The healthcare industry depends heavily on reliable supply chains to ensure the timely delivery of medical equipment, pharmaceuticals, diagnostic products, protective gear, and essential healthcare materials. Logistics providers are playing a larger role in supporting operational continuity, patient care, and inventory efficiency.
